The Particulars of a Pro Studio

Professional music studios are fundamentally different from other commercial environments. They’re filled with high-sensitivity microphones, large-format mixing consoles, and sometimes tens of thousands of dollars’ worth of instruments. Each piece of equipment can pick up even the faintest ambient noise. In typical office buildings or residential homes, a slight hum from an air conditioner might go unnoticed or be considered a minor annoyance. In a recording studio, that same hum can ruin an entire day’s work.

Additionally, temperature control is not just about human comfort. High-end audio gear generates heat when in operation, which can lead to performance issues if the environment is not carefully regulated. Excess humidity can damage delicate circuit boards or create unwanted static in audio signals. Extreme dryness, on the other hand, can cause wooden instruments to warp and degrade.

Product Recommendations

After Nathan detailed the studio’s specific constraints—especially the need for near-silent operation—AC Direct suggested a multi-pronged approach:

  1. Ultra-Quiet Mini-Split Systems
    Mini-split systems are renowned for their low decibel levels compared to traditional HVAC setups. AC Direct pointed Nathan toward models that have an outstanding track record of silent operation. The indoor air handler units in these systems are designed with minimal fan noise, and the compressors, located outdoors, reduce the majority of operational sounds.

  2. Soundproofing Accessories
    Merely choosing a quiet system isn’t always enough. AC Direct recommended insulated line sets, vibration-dampening mounts, and sound blankets for any external compressor units. These accessories reduce mechanical reverberations that could travel through walls, ceilings, or structural elements of the building.

  3. Zoned Cooling
    For maximum efficiency and pinpoint climate control, AC Direct advocated for multiple zones. Rather than having one large system handling the entire studio, smaller, dedicated systems can be controlled independently. This approach not only provides quieter operation but also ensures the temperature remains stable in each unique studio section—whether it’s the live room with musicians, the vocal booth for singers, or the control room where the producer monitors all audio data.

The Execution: Turning Challenges into Opportunities

Phase 1: Pre-Installation Planning

Before installing a single piece of hardware, Nathan and his small team carried out a rigorous planning phase. They measured every inch of the studio, from the larger live room to the smaller vocal booths and the gear-laden control room. To ensure optimal air circulation without interfering with acoustics, they mapped out potential unit placements that would minimize airflow noise. This meant locating indoor air handlers in areas that wouldn’t send air blowing directly across microphones or sensitive audio equipment.

During this phase, Nathan also worked closely with the studio’s acoustician—a professional responsible for analyzing the room’s sonic properties. By collaborating, they ensured that any structural modifications for the HVAC system wouldn’t conflict with the acoustic treatments already in place, such as bass traps, diffusors, and sound-absorbing panels. This level of coordination helped avoid costly rework and potential conflicts between air handling and sound engineering.

Phase 2: Discreet Placement and Zoning

Armed with AC Direct’s recommendations, Nathan divided the studio into three distinct zones:

  1. The Live Room – Where most band recordings happen, requiring robust cooling to offset heat from people and equipment.
  2. The Vocal Booth – A smaller, enclosed space, prone to temperature spikes due to its low volume of air and the body heat of vocalists.
  3. The Control Room – The nerve center of the operation, with high-end computers, mixing consoles, and engineers who need a comfortable, quiet environment over extended sessions.

Each zone received its own ductless mini-split system. Nathan installed the indoor units so they’d remain unobtrusive and away from the main reflection points of sound. The lines running between these indoor units and the outdoor condensers were insulated meticulously, using specialized insulation materials that dampen vibration. Additionally, flexible mounts were utilized to ensure no direct contact between the lines and the building’s structure—reducing the risk of structure-borne noise.

Phase 3: Vibration Control and Soundproofing

Soundproofing an HVAC system entails more than picking a quiet machine. Nathan added vibration-dampening mounts at every possible juncture, including the points where the indoor air handlers affixed to the walls. These mounts absorbed micro-vibrations that could otherwise transfer into the wall studs, floors, or ceilings—potentially creating low-frequency hums.

Outside, the compressors were installed on heavy-duty concrete pads fitted with anti-vibration accessories. AC Direct’s sound blanket kit was deployed around each compressor unit to mitigate any motor noise seeping into the studio. By layering these solutions, Nathan effectively tackled potential noise leaks at multiple points, creating an ultra-silent environment across the entire HVAC system.

Phase 4: After-Hours Installation

Timing was everything. The studio’s schedule was loaded with daily sessions—sometimes running late into the night with artists chasing creative sparks. To accommodate this, Nathan and his crew frequently worked during the early mornings or on days the studio was closed. This flexible approach demanded significant logistical coordination, but it also allowed the studio to function without downtime.

Working off-hours had the added benefit of minimizing the impact of installation noise. Drilling holes, installing mounts, and positioning compressors can be distracting. By carrying out these tasks at strategic times, Nathan ensured the studio could maintain its normal operation and avoid costly session cancellations.

Phase 5: Testing and Fine-Tuning

No high-end HVAC installation is complete without a thorough test phase. Once the system was in place, Nathan spent several hours running the mini-split units under different conditions. He measured decibel levels in various points around the studio, checked for consistent air distribution, and monitored the temperature and humidity in each zone. If he noticed even the slightest whir, buzz, or temperature fluctuation, he made immediate tweaks—adjusting fan speeds, repositioning line sets, or recalibrating zone controls.

The collaboration with the studio’s acoustician resumed here as well. They did multiple test recordings—some capturing silence, others capturing subtle background tracks—to confirm the noise floor was as low as possible. They listened for any humming that might appear on sensitive condenser microphones or near instruments like acoustic guitars. The result? Silence. The system operated at a noise level so low it was nearly imperceptible on high-gain recordings.

Frequently Asked Questions (FAQs)

How critical is the location of indoor units in a music studio setup?

Location is extremely important. Even if the units are quiet, you want to ensure airflow won’t blow directly onto microphones or sensitive instruments. Proper planning with an acoustician can guide you to the optimal placement that balances temperature distribution with minimal sound interference.

Are mini-split systems always the best option for silence?

Mini-splits are often favored for their quiet operation and flexible zoning, but they’re not the only solution. Some ducted systems with well-designed ducting and advanced fan technology can also be low-noise. The best choice depends on the size of the space, its usage patterns, and its structural limitations.

What if I only need to upgrade parts of my existing HVAC system in a studio?

Partial upgrades are possible. You can replace older components like the outdoor condenser with a newer, quieter model and improve ductwork insulation. However, ensure the new components are compatible with the existing system. Consulting with HVAC experts like AC Direct can help you avoid mismatches.

How does humidity control factor into music studio HVAC?

Humidity is crucial in a music studio to preserve instruments and electronics. Depending on your local climate, you may need humidifiers or dehumidifiers integrated into your system. Maintaining relative humidity in a stable range (often between 40–50%) can protect wood instruments and electronic components.

Are there any specific certifications or standards I should look for in HVAC equipment for studios?

Look for AHRI-certified systems, as these have undergone third-party testing for efficiency and performance. Noise ratings in decibels (dB) are also critical—especially for the indoor unit. Some manufacturers highlight “whisper-quiet” operation with decibel levels in the low 20s range, which is ideal for recording studios.
